The Verdict
Skyvegas Casino provides a range of withdrawal options that cater to various player needs, but there are notable pros and cons to consider. While the app is user-friendly and responsive, some withdrawal methods can be slow and may have high limits. Below, we explore the strengths and weaknesses of their withdrawal process.
The Good
- Variety of Withdrawal Options: Players can choose from several methods, including debit cards, e-wallets, and bank transfers, ensuring flexibility in how they receive their winnings.
- Mobile Optimisation: The Skyvegas app is well-designed for mobile use, allowing players to manage their accounts and initiate withdrawals seamlessly.
- Secure Transactions: The platform is licensed by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), providing a safe environment for financial transactions.
- Instant Withdrawals for E-Wallets: Players using e-wallets like PayPal can enjoy instant withdrawals, improving overall satisfaction.
The Bad
- Withdrawal Processing Times: While e-wallets offer instant withdrawals, debit card and bank transfer options can take up to 5-7 business days, which may frustrate players eager to access their funds.
- High Minimum Withdrawal Limits: The minimum withdrawal limit is often set at £10, which can be relatively high for casual players.
- Wagering Requirements: Some bonuses come with wagering requirements of up to 35x, making it challenging to withdraw winnings derived from bonus funds.
The Ugly
- Withdrawal Fees: Certain withdrawal methods may incur fees, particularly bank transfers, which can diminish the overall winnings for players.
- Lack of Support for Some Methods: Not all payment methods are available for withdrawals, which can limit options for some users. For example, while you can deposit via various e-wallets, a withdrawal might require a different method.
- Customer Support Issues: Players have reported delays in responses from customer support regarding withdrawal queries, causing frustration when issues arise.
| Withdrawal Method | Processing Time | Minimum Withdrawal | Fees |
|---|---|---|---|
| Debit Card | 3-5 Business Days | £10 | £0 |
| Bank Transfer | 5-7 Business Days | £10 | £1.50 |
| PayPal | Instant | £10 | £0 |
| Skrill | Instant | £10 | £0 |
